    Worst bike shop I've ever been to.
    Rear linkage problem with my Giant full suspension. It had developed some side to side play. I've already got the bike partially disassembled when I take it to Earls. They tell me no problem, should have it fixed in no time. Before I make it home they call to tell me they do need to reassemble the bike to diagnose the problem. This is annoying as I live near an hour away. I take them the parts.
    So they call to tell me it's finished and reassembled except my chain guide. They would be happy to put it back on and charge me more labor fees instead of putting it on the 1st time. No thanks!
    I pick up my bike. Linkage has the same amount of play as it did when I dropped it off. I say to the young kid working there that it's not fixed.
    His reply "They fixed it the best they could without getting new parts"
    I repeat that it's not fixed.
    He repeats his original answer.
    I ask for a manager
    He's the only one there
    So I had to pay $55 to just get my bike back, not fixed mind you.
    So I return home and contact Earls via email and explain what happened. Did offer a refund, store credit, or even apologize? Nope, they said to give them a call and we could discuss it. Sorry, no thanks. Tried that when I picked up my bike.
    I won't ever set foot in that store again

    Took my old hybrid there a couple years ago to have the shifters fixed. When I was at the register to check out, the employee says, "Oh, looks like you need a brake adjustment," and turns one of the screws a bit. He didn't ask, he just did it. I know how to adjust brakes, it's not something I would ever pay anybody to do, and for some reason I was under the assumption he was doing it just because it was such a minor job. It took him less than 30 seconds, and he charged me the full amount for a brake adjustment. I was about to finish up a break from work, so I didn't bother arguing, just stood there stupefied and disgruntled for a bit.

    The shifters worked fine, but as for the brake adjustment... never have I experienced anything like that at any other bicycle shop. I payed and went on my way, never been back.
